A Tacit UTXO is a P2TR output whose committed amount is hidden behind a Pedersen commitment. The amount is recoverable only by the recipient (or, for T_PMINT/T_WITHDRAW outputs, public on chain).

Validating this UTXO end-to-end requires walking ancestry back to the etch envelope and verifying every kernel signature and rangeproof on the path. tacitscan stores the bytes for the proofs but does not gate the page on verification — that's a deliberate trade for explorer responsiveness.
